On the columns tab in the password protected settings dialog, the database administrator can color code columns by controling the background and foreground colors.

This unique dbWindow feature is unprecedented. Now, your color coded columns can help users easily identify certain columns to act upon. For example, red columns may indicate values are read only, yellow columns may indicate values must be unique, while green columns may indicate values must be nonnull.
